Saint of the Day Quote: Saint Acacius

Acacius was a priest at Sebaste, Armenia, during Diocletian’s persecution. He was arrested and executed under the governor Maximus with seven women and Hirenarchus, who was so impressed with the devotion to their faith he became a Christian and suffered the same fate. His feast day is November 27th.
